-------------------------------------------------------------------
Tue Dec 16 15:55:11 UTC 2025 - Giacomo Comes <gcomes.obs@gmail.com>
- use return insted of exit in 20-ibus-plasma-setup.sh
* such script is sourced not executed, when using exit other
scripts in the same directory are not sourced anymore
* fix boo#1255237
